SwiftStream


Introducing the cutting-edge FPGA development board with a compact M.2 form factor, designed to deliver exceptional performance and versatility. This advanced board is equipped with powerful components that make it an ideal choice for a wide range of applications. 

At its core, the board features the Altera Cyclone V FPGA, a high-performance field-programmable gate array that empowers the device with unparalleled processing capabilities. This FPGA opens up possibilities for flexible and customizable functionality, making it well-suited for demanding tasks across various industries.

To ensure precision and synchronization, the board incorporates the SI5338 clock generator IC. This component plays a crucial role in maintaining accurate timing signals, contributing to the overall efficiency and reliability of the system.

For video input and output, the board is equipped with two SDI ports, supporting up to 3G/HD resolutions. One port is dedicated to SDI input, while the other serves as a versatile SDI input/output, providing flexibility for a variety of video processing applications.

Additionally, the M.2 PCIe interface enhances the board's connectivity options, enabling high-speed data transfer and expanding its compatibility with a wide range of peripherals. This feature ensures that the board remains adaptable to evolving technological requirements.

In summary, this M.2 form factor board is a powerhouse of innovation, incorporating the Altera Cyclone V FPGA, SI5338 clock generator IC, EEPROM, and dual SDI ports with M.2 PCIe interface. Its compact design and feature-rich architecture make it an ideal solution for applications demanding high-performance computing, precise timing, and versatile video processing capabilities.
